Combining filler and biostimulator in the lower face is not a compromise between two approaches. It is a division of labour, and getting it right depends on being able to say, out loud, which product is doing which job.
The short form of the rule I teach: a little filler to help you lift, a little biostimulator to work on skin quality — especially in the lower part of the face, to avoid heaviness. The lower third is where combination logic matters most, because it is the region that punishes over-volumisation harder than anywhere else on the face. Add weight below the zygomatic arch and you do not produce youth. You produce descent.

Why the lower face is the unforgiving region
Three reasons, and they compound.
The vector is wrong. In the midface, added volume in a deep compartment sits on bone and has somewhere to push from. In the lower face, you are frequently adding volume to tissue that is already descending, in a plane with less skeletal support beneath it. The product goes where gravity is already taking the face.
Weight reads as age. The lower third of a young face is comparatively light and defined. Adding bulk to jowls, to the prejowl sulcus, to the lower cheek, does not restore that — it produces a heavier lower face, and a heavy lower face is one of the reliable visual cues of aging. The patient gets older-looking, more product, and no idea why.
It fails on animation before it fails at rest. Lower-face product is placed and assessed with the face still. Speech, smiling and chewing all move it. Review work on facial overfilled syndrome describes exactly this mechanism in the midface — the compartments and the injected material protrude forward together on smiling, and excess volume amplifies that shift — and the lower face has more mobility, not less (Zhou C, Che Q, Zhao R, Wang H, Wa Q. Clin Cosmet Investig Dermatol. 2026;19:doi:10.2147/CCID.S600459).
So the question in the lower face is never "how much filler". It is "how little filler, placed exactly where, and what is doing the rest of the work".
The division of labour
Write the plan in two columns.
Filler does structure. Defined points, defined compartments, immediate and reversible. Its job is projection and support where projection and support have genuinely been lost — the anterior chin, the mandibular angle, a specific contour deficiency you can point to and name. Small volumes, deep planes, discrete sites.
The biostimulator does quality. A field, not a point. Its job is dermal thickness, firmness and texture across the region, delivered subdermally and diffusely, contributing no meaningful volume of its own.
The reason this division works is that the two complaints patients bring about the lower face — "it's lost its shape" and "the skin here has gone" — are genuinely different findings with different treatments. Answering both with filler is how the region gets overfilled. Answering both with a biostimulator produces better skin on an unsupported jawline.
Be honest about what the structural half can claim. A 2026 critical review in JPRAS Open found that "lift" in the filler literature has no consensus operational definition, that all published quantitative measurements track the skin surface rather than deeper structures, that reported millimetre-scale effects are often within the measurement error of the imaging used, and that dose–response analyses show a non-monotonic rather than dose-dependent relationship between volume and displacement (Harris S, Michon A. JPRAS Open. 2026;51:646–656. doi:10.1016/j.jpra.2026.07.028). That measurement literature is one more argument for keeping the structural component small and asking a second product to do the other job.
Which pairings work
Structural CaHA plus hyperdilute CaHA — the same product, two jobs
The cleanest combination in the lower face uses one device at two preparations. Undiluted product provides deep volume and structural support at the chin, jawline and temples; more dilute product at 1:1 and 1:2 provides some volume and smooths transitions across the face; and hyperdilute preparations cover a wider surface area in the face, neck or décolletage to tighten skin and improve skin quality (Green JB, Biesman BS, Hill DA, Kwok GP, Levin M, Sergeeva D. Aesthet Surg J Open Forum. 2025;7:ojae119. doi:10.1093/asjof/ojae119).
Note that the lidocaine-containing formulation carries an on-label indication for deep subdermal and/or supraperiosteal injection for soft tissue augmentation to improve moderate to severe loss of jawline contour in adults over 21, approved in 2021. The structural half of this pairing has a labelled home in exactly the region under discussion. The hyperdilute half does not — outside the 1:2 décolleté indication approved in March 2026, dilution remains off-label.
The reason this pairing is attractive is that you are not asking the patient's tissue to negotiate with two unrelated materials. Same particles, same resorption behaviour, different preparation, different plane, different job.
HA filler for structure plus PLLA for the field
Where reversibility matters — a patient new to injectables, an uncertain plan, a compartment you might want to undo — put a small volume of hyaluronic acid deep at the structural points and run PLLA subdermally across the cheek and prejowl region for quality.
Two cautions from the PLLA labelling, both frequently ignored:
- Safety and effectiveness of PLLA has not been systematically evaluated with other drugs (other than lidocaine), substances, filler products, implants or devices used prior to or during the same treatment session.
- Other filler products should not be directly mixed with PLLA. No interaction studies exist.
"Not systematically evaluated" is not "contraindicated" — combination is routine practice and the facelift chart-review literature shows most aesthetic patients carry several product histories. But it does mean you are operating outside studied territory, and it means the instruction not to mix in the syringe is absolute.
Hyperdilute CaHA for quality, then HA for structure, in sequence
The perioral region is the best-documented example of treating the two findings as separate jobs done at separate visits. A pilot study injected hyperdilute CaHA at 1:3 throughout the perioral region at two intervals, weeks 1 and 8, followed by hyaluronic acid into the perioral region at week 16 (Somenek M. Aesthet Surg J Open Forum. 2024;6:ojae021. doi:10.1093/asjof/ojae021).
The logic generalises: improve the quality of the envelope first, then decide how much structure it actually needs. Faces frequently need less structural product after the quality work than the initial assessment suggested — which is an argument for this order rather than the reverse.
Skin booster plus structural filler
Appropriate where the superficial complaint is genuinely hydration and fine texture rather than laxity. The booster goes intradermally as micro-droplets; the filler goes deep at defined points. They do not interact because they are not in the same tissue.
The failure mode is using the booster as a substitute for a laxity treatment because it is the easier sale. That patient is covered separately in this cluster and usually should not be treated with a booster at all.
Which pairings do not work
Two volumisers in the same compartment. If you are considering neat CaHA and a high-G′ HA in the same deep plane in the same region, you have not made a decision, you have made a purchase. Pick one.
A biostimulator as a substitute for structure. Biostimulators do not add volume and do not replace surgery. If the finding is a genuine projection deficit, no amount of collagen stimulation across the field will create it.
A skin booster as a substitute for a laxity plan. Covered above and worth repeating because it is the most common version of this error.
Anything superficial and particulate in a highly mobile lower-face region. The PLLA nodule literature repeatedly names the nasolabial folds and the prejowl sulcus among the higher-risk sites, alongside periorbital, temporal and glabellar regions. Mobility plus superficial particulate is the recipe.
Mixing products in the syringe. Never, for any of these combinations.
Plane deconfliction
The single most useful discipline in combination work is writing the plane next to every product in the plan.
| Job | Product | Plane |
|---|---|---|
| Chin and mandibular angle projection | Neat CaHA or high-G′ HA | Supraperiosteal |
| Jawline contour support | Neat CaHA (lidocaine formulation, on-label) | Deep subdermal / supraperiosteal |
| Field quality across lower cheek and prejowl | Hyperdilute CaHA or PLLA | Subdermal |
| Fine perioral texture | HA skin booster | Intradermal microdroplet |
Two products in the same plane in the same region in the same session is where distribution becomes unpredictable and where "she had a lot done that day" becomes the only available account of a poor result. Separate by plane, separate by site, or separate by visit.
Getting the proportion right
The rule is not "combine". It is "combine conservatively".
Start with less filler than the assessment suggests. You can add at the review. You cannot subtract a biostimulator at all, and you can only subtract HA with an enzyme and a difficult conversation.
Let the quality work run first where you can. As above — a lower face with better dermal quality frequently needs less structural volume than it appeared to at baseline.
Assess in animation before you finish. Speak to the patient, have them smile, watch the region move. Lower-face product that is acceptable at rest and wrong in motion is a result you will be managing for months.
Do not treat every finding in one sitting. Being conservative is the point. When you over-treat a patient, that is when you start changing people's faces — and patients are afraid of looking different, not of looking their age.
Record product, dilution, volume, plane and site for each component. A combination plan without that record cannot be reasoned about at the next visit.
